View All
View All
View All
View All
View All
View All
View All
View All
View All
View All
View All
View All
View All

JQuery Tutorial for Beginners: Step-by-Step Explanation

By Pavan Vadapalli

Updated on Sep 29, 2023 | 6 min read | 5.4k views

Share:

Thinking about avenues you would receive after being a part of a JQuery tutorial? 

It can be regarded as one of the best-used programming languages even after the pandemic year of 2020. Since it has excellent versatility and extensibility, the language has successfully changed the methods of writing JavaScript used by billions of people. JQuery can create things such as HTML document transversal, handling of events, animation and an API accessible via various servers.

Regardless of several concerns about the language, it is still the best JavaScript library that you can learn as a beginner. 

If you are wondering where to get a JQuery tutorial for beginners, this article will pave your path to the basics of this language and the courses available. 

Check out our free courses related to software development.

What is JQuery?

JQuery is an open-sourced, highly featured JavaScript library. Its primary function is to simplify the creation and navigation of data applications, especially HTML Document Object Model (DOM) manipulation. Other objectives include asynchronous JavaScript and XML, along with event handling. Also, JQuery uses JavaScript functionalities by focussing on CSS properties to include effects such as fade-in and outs for websites.

DOM Manipulation allows users to search, select, and construct elements with certain specific properties. Users can mark changes in various attributes and be a part of several events. AJax is mostly used to share data between browsers and servers without the necessity of reloading webpages. Event handling deals with an event handler who gets an object upon an event.  

A JQuery guide can help you understand the details of such processes. 

Coverage of AWS, Microsoft Azure and GCP services

Certification8 Months
View Program

Job-Linked Program

Bootcamp36 Weeks
View Program

Enroll in Software Engineering Courses from the World’s top Universities. Earn Executive PG Programs, Advanced Certificate Programs, or Masters Programs to fast-track your career.

What are the types of JQuery Methods?

  • DOM Methods:

    Some of the DOM Manipulation methods include:  

  • addclass(): This builds up the specified class or several classes to the events.
  • afterclass(): Insert a specific data or content after each mentioned tag.
  • clone(): This refers to the deep copying of a sourced element.
  • Hasclass(): This involves the addition of a specific class to a certain applicable element.
  • Position(): It adds a specific element to the parent specimen.
  • text(): This brings about a string value to the texts built with particular elements.
  • wrap(): This involves building a distinct structure all around the set of determined elements.
  • Traversing:

    This pattern follows a parent-child hierarchy while navigating one element to another.

  • closest(): This component identifies the ideal element for the determined selector.
  • has(): A specified selector is added if the element requires one.
  • prev(): This brings about the immediate sibling of current selectors.
  • Event Triggering:

    This takes care of browser interaction. These include:

  • bind(): Involving attachment, this function imparts stronger event handling abilities to the particular element.
  • error(): Error handling is mainly managed to turn the specified element more accessible.
  • focus(): This creates a focus event handling for a particular set.

What are the uses of JQuery?

JQuery is an extremely well-defined language because it did not have any changes or new methods added to it. Here is a JQuery guide regarding its following uses:

  • Plugins: Plugins are referred to as pieces of code mentioned in any JavaScript file.
  • DOM Manipulation: Selection of DOM elements, modification and negotiations using Sizzle, a cross-border source selector.
  • Animations and AJax Support: One of the main features of JQuery is its inbuilt animation effects. An accountable and responsive feature can be developed using AJax technology. Hence, it can turn web pages more exciting and more user friendly.
  • Cross-browser Support: This system functions on every possible browser. It also supports basic X path syntax and CSS3 selectors.
  • More Performance than WriteUps: Various tasks are required for JavaScript codes to build a single line. This refers to the faster loading of web pages.
  • Easy Learning: Since it is built on comparatively shorter code than JavaScript, JQuery does not require complex prerequisites. The time taken to perform the whole act is also reduced and simultaneously provides a set of plug-ins. 
  • Usage of SEO: Search Engine Optimization is used almost everywhere right now. Almost similar to Flash, it provides content to all search engine bots.
  • Visual Studio IDE: It creates extensions that can integrate due to the JQuery library. An IntelliSense item can be switched on, allowing you to easily recognise syntax errors and support methods of auto-population. 

Benefits of JQuery: 

Using JQuery offers the following advantages: 

  • A widely used language: Used mainly by website developers, the language provides you with the scope of various information such as code snippets and blog posts. 
  • Promotion of simplicity: Since the language is based on short and simple codes, it promotes great work within a short period. 
  • Lightweight and Lean: Due to such characteristics, most functions have been disabled, and the remaining ones are sent to the plug-in sections. The core JQuery library is around 24kb, smaller than the size of a photograph.
  • Fast loading of pages: Search engines such as Google consider load time as a primary factor in ranking websites. JQuery also stores files separately, which emerge on the page. It allows developers to design modifications to the whole website after using a specific repository instead of going through several folders. 
  • Utility Features: The language provides several utility functions, such as coding string operations, array manipulation, and trimming. The code-writing procedures turn easy and hassle-free with such characteristics.

Summing Up

JQuery is one of the most popular languages you can ever grasp due to its simplicity. JavaScript will turn more accessible once you comprehend the whole language. A Jquery tutorial can be taken if you want to proceed with programming languages. It’s a proficiency that can be beneficial for your resume.

Wondering how to be a part of the Jquery tutorial for beginners? 

JQuery Tutorial gets easier with UpGrad’s Full Stack Software Development Certification. This is one of the best certificate courses you can be a part of due for the following reasons.

  • This 13-month course demands 12-15 hrs dedication per week
  • Has an IIIT Bangalore Alumni Status, one of the best colleges in the country
  • Four months of Executive Certification in Data Science and Machine Learning, free of cost
  • Ten Programming tools and languages
  • A software career transition boot camp for non-tech coders and new coders
  • 7+ case studies along with projects
  • No Cost EMI Option
  • Job Fairs, Mock Interviews: UpGrad’s 360-degree support
  • Online sessions along with Live lectures

The syllabus of this course is also well-structured by industry experts. The minimum eligibility for this course is 50% in your Bachelor’s level. Prior coding is also not necessary if you want to enter the program. 

Sign up today to learn more and become an expert!

Frequently Asked Questions (FAQs)

1. What should be learnt before understanding Jquery?

2. What is the major disadvantage of JQuery?

3. Which should be learnt first: Javascript or JQuery?

Pavan Vadapalli

899 articles published

Get Free Consultation

+91

By submitting, I accept the T&C and
Privacy Policy

India’s #1 Tech University

Executive PG Certification in AI-Powered Full Stack Development

77%

seats filled

View Program

Top Resources

Recommended Programs

upGrad

AWS | upGrad KnowledgeHut

AWS Certified Solutions Architect - Associate Training (SAA-C03)

69 Cloud Lab Simulations

Certification

32-Hr Training by Dustin Brimberry

View Program
upGrad

Microsoft | upGrad KnowledgeHut

Microsoft Azure Data Engineering Certification

Access Digital Learning Library

Certification

45 Hrs Live Expert-Led Training

View Program
upGrad

upGrad KnowledgeHut

Professional Certificate Program in UI/UX Design & Design Thinking

#1 Course for UI/UX Designers

Bootcamp

3 Months

View Program